wikipedia tailings from wikipedia, the free encyclopedia jump to navigation jump to search a panorama of broken hill , new south wales , backed by the man-made tailings from the line of lode mine. the tailings heaps stretch across this image. tailings are the materials left over after the process of separating
the valuable fraction from the uneconomic fraction ( gangue ) of an ore . tailings are distinct from overburden , which is the waste rock or other material that overlies an ore or mineral body and is displaced during mining without being processed. the extraction of minerals from ore can be done two...

and columbite (alternately, niobate) actually have the same chemical structure, the two names reflecting a difference in relative proportion of tantalum to niobium. the history of the two elements is similarly entwined. in , british chemist and mineralogist charles hatchett became intrigued by a mineral
had been sent decades earlier from the american colonies by connecticut governor john winthrop. his analysis of the sample yielded a substance he believed contained a heretofore undiscovered element that he named "columbium" for columbia, the symbolic female embodiment of the united states, and the mineral...
